Details
-
Type: Improvement
-
Status: Open
-
Priority: Minor
-
Resolution: Unresolved
-
Affects Version/s: 4.6.0
-
Fix Version/s: Short Term
-
Component/s: Client Interface, Plugins, Staff Interface
-
Labels:None
Description
There are cases when we may not want to display the "Label" for a config option field, or when we may want to display the Config Option Group name.
Let's discuss, but this is what I'm proposing:
- Add 2 fields when creating/editing a Configurable Option Group (Display Group Name, and Display Option Labels) For compatibility, the 1st would not be checked by default, but the second would.
- Update the order forms to recognize this change, and display the group name if required, or omit the field labels if required.
Use Case
See the attached screenshot. It is often desirable to have a single label for checkboxes. For example:
Software (The label, here it's the Config Option Group name)
[ ] DirectAdmin
[ ] KernelCare
[ ] Softaculous
[ ] CloudLinux
Currently we have the label and the option, and it takes up more vertical space and we have a lot of repetition in the naming.
Activity
Paul Phillips
created issue -
Paul Phillips
made changes -
Field | Original Value | New Value |
---|---|---|
Description |
There are cases when we may not want to display the "Label" for a config option field, or when we may want to display the Config Option Group name.
Let's discuss, but this is what I'm proposing: * Add 2 fields when creating/editing a Configurable Option Group (Display Group Name, and Display Option Labels) For compatibility, the 1st would not be checked by default, but the second would. * Update the order forms to recognize this change, and display the group name if required, or omit the field labels if required. ### Use Case See the attached screenshot. It is often desirable to have a single label for checkboxes. For example: Software (The label) [ ] DirectAdmin [ ] KernelCare [ ] Softaculous [ ] CloudLinux Currently we have the label and the option, and it takes up more vertical space and we have a lot of repetition in the naming. |
There are cases when we may not want to display the "Label" for a config option field, or when we may want to display the Config Option Group name.
Let's discuss, but this is what I'm proposing: * Add 2 fields when creating/editing a Configurable Option Group (Display Group Name, and Display Option Labels) For compatibility, the 1st would not be checked by default, but the second would. * Update the order forms to recognize this change, and display the group name if required, or omit the field labels if required. h3. Use Case See the attached screenshot. It is often desirable to have a single label for checkboxes. For example: Software (The label) [ ] DirectAdmin [ ] KernelCare [ ] Softaculous [ ] CloudLinux Currently we have the label and the option, and it takes up more vertical space and we have a lot of repetition in the naming. |
Paul Phillips
made changes -
Description |
There are cases when we may not want to display the "Label" for a config option field, or when we may want to display the Config Option Group name.
Let's discuss, but this is what I'm proposing: * Add 2 fields when creating/editing a Configurable Option Group (Display Group Name, and Display Option Labels) For compatibility, the 1st would not be checked by default, but the second would. * Update the order forms to recognize this change, and display the group name if required, or omit the field labels if required. h3. Use Case See the attached screenshot. It is often desirable to have a single label for checkboxes. For example: Software (The label) [ ] DirectAdmin [ ] KernelCare [ ] Softaculous [ ] CloudLinux Currently we have the label and the option, and it takes up more vertical space and we have a lot of repetition in the naming. |
There are cases when we may not want to display the "Label" for a config option field, or when we may want to display the Config Option Group name.
Let's discuss, but this is what I'm proposing: * Add 2 fields when creating/editing a Configurable Option Group (Display Group Name, and Display Option Labels) For compatibility, the 1st would not be checked by default, but the second would. * Update the order forms to recognize this change, and display the group name if required, or omit the field labels if required. h3. Use Case See the attached screenshot. It is often desirable to have a single label for checkboxes. For example: Software (The label, here it's the Config Option Group name) [ ] DirectAdmin [ ] KernelCare [ ] Softaculous [ ] CloudLinux Currently we have the label and the option, and it takes up more vertical space and we have a lot of repetition in the naming. |
Tyson Phillips (Inactive)
made changes -
Rank | Ranked higher |
Tyson Phillips (Inactive)
made changes -
Rank | Ranked higher |
Tyson Phillips (Inactive)
made changes -
Story Points | 5 |
In the order summary it would be ideal if it also showed the Group Name - Option Name instead of Label - Option Name.
e.g.
Software - DirectAdmin
Instead of:
DirectAdmin - DirectAdmin